A new MUX Vst 1.1.0 package is available in http://www.mutools.com/mux/cedar

What's changed since version 1.0.38:

New
  • New Note Key/Vel Filter module.
  • New Bit Reducer module.
  • New Samplerate Reducer module.
Tuned
  • The "SetChunkMustCallUpdateDispay" preference now defaults to 1 so this feature is active by default.
  • Text string editors: Shift+Home selects from start to cursor, Shift+End selects from cursor to end.
  • "Audio To Note Gate" renamed to "Audio Envelope Follower" and includes a modulation output.
  • Finetuned the "Manage Audio/Sample Files" function.
  • File path editors are much wider by default so to display more of longer file paths.
  • Fixed/Tuned: By default VST parameter values are shown as % values, no mixed situations anymore.
  • More relaxed checking of the user key e.g. line breaks in the key are filtered out.
  • Event Monitor now has a "Clear" context function.
  • Tweaked several aspects in the UI.
  • Finetuned an UI detail in the parameter drag-drop system.
  • Finetuned a detail in the module parameter handling resulting in even smoother parameter slides via UI or automation.
  • All windows now properly do maximize/restore. So after a maximize you can restore to the previous position/size.
  • Double-clicking a window title bar also does maximize/restore.
Fixed
  • Fixed a bug which could cause different kinds of problems in the 64 bit version.
  • Improved MIDI input controller support.
  • Fixed a little bug that caused an improper focus box in some situations.
  • Audio Envelope Follower now properly saves Key and Velocity properties.
  • Fixed a little bug in the object naming system.
  • Fixed: UI splitters didn't show a hand cursor anymore.
  • When editing a parameter mapping, Cancel did not restore the original values.
  • Fixed a bug in the parameter modulation system which caused individual modulations to be unintendedly bound to the [-100% - +100%] range.

The new MUX Vst 1.2.0 patch is available in http://www.mutools.com/mux/cedar

What's changed since version 1.1.0:
  • New: Modulation Monitor
  • You can now copy-paste selections of audio files/samples directly into an oscillator.
  • Waveform -> "Open" now previews the audio files while browsing.
  • In some cases "Show Clipboard Contents" didn't show the most detailed info.
  • OSX: When doing "Move To Top-Left" for a window, the apple title bar now is taken into account.
  • Fixed a bug when using parent modulation towards the PolySynth.
  • Fixed a bug wrt using VST synths in a MUX, then such saved MUX preset was not categorized as an instrument preset.
Installation:

* Make sure you have installed MUX Vst 1.1.0, see start of this topic.
* Download the new patch zip for your platform.
* Extract the new DLL files and copy it into your MUX Vst 1.1.0 folder, replacing the previous MUX.dll and MUX (Vst Synth).dll.

If i save a mux without an instrument in (ie event + audio input, mixer strip and audio output) then it won't show up on the "Add instrument track" -> "Mutools".

I've tried to add a vst and save - it shows up on the list. If i remove the vst and save - it's gone.

I wan't to have an initialized mux there for fast muxing :) Maybe it's to make sure that only "real" mux instruments show up and not effects?
:hug:

Post

Crackbaby wrote:Maybe it's to make sure that only "real" mux instruments show up and not effects?
Yes indeed. A MUX preset is tagged as an instrument when it contains an instrument i.e. a VST synth or a PolySynth.
